APC extends liability limits
Underwriting agency APC has increased the limits on the majority of its public and products liability risks to £10m and property risks to £50m in a move that it claims will help smaller brokers win larger clients.

Lloyd’s consortium has construction covered
Four construction risks syndicates in the Lloyd’s market have joined forces to offer underwriting capacity of up to $166m (£108m), in a move that seeks to place the consortium at the forefront of insuring the largest construction risks in the world,…
Catlin reports 12% GWP hike in cat-free quarter
Catlin has reported a 12% increase in gross written premium to $1.84m in the first quarter of the year compared to the same period in 2012 (Q1 2012: $1.64m).

Beazley records 11% Q1 premium increase
Growth in the marine division has seen Beazley record gross written premiums up 11% to $518m (£333m), increasing from last year’s Q1 total of $465m.
